  • Abstract
    This paper addresses the rate maintenance requirement of video watermarking and proposes a differential energy watermarking (DEM) scheme. We embed a watermark bit by shifting the energy difference between horizontal edge components and the vertical ones in a quantized luminance block within a quantization cell, and spread the slight shift over coefficients for good quality and robustness. Since a slightly changed coefficient will possibly share the same segment code and a similar code-length with its un-watermarked precedent, our method could simplify the rate allocation strategy. Experimental results demonstrate that our DEM scheme performs better on visual quality impact, capacity, robustness and rate maintenance than the DEW (differential energy watermarking) scheme.
